每年,IQ Hero Bot 都会从 IQ Super Kit 开始设计,为团队提供玩当前 VEX IQ Challenge 游戏的起点。 它旨在让经验丰富的团队能够快速组装机器人来研究游戏的动态。 新队伍还可以使用英雄机器人来学习宝贵的建造技能,并拥有一个可以定制的机器人,以便在赛季初进行比赛。
2021-2022 年 VEX IQ 挑战赛即将开始。 查看本页 了解有关该游戏及其玩法的更多信息。 本赛季扮演投球角色的英雄机器人是 Fling。 您可以查看 Fling 的 构建说明 了解更多信息。
有关本文中使用的游戏定义、游戏规则概述和评分, 请参阅投球游戏手册。
评分能力
Fling可以通过以下方式得分:
射入高球
使用 Fling 的进气口和弹射臂,可以有效地将球射入高球。
低球得分
使用 Fling 的进气口可以轻松地将球推入低球门。
清除畜栏中的球
Fling 可以使用入口有效地清除畜栏中的球。
悬挂杆的低悬挂
投掷能够使用弹射臂从悬挂杆上向上或向下悬挂。
设计特点
Fling 的一些突出设计特点包括进气口、曲柄设计弹射器发射系统以及用于移动弹射器臂的复合齿轮比。
进球量
Fling 的入口由两个由支架隔开的 40 毫米 (mm) 滑轮和四个在滑轮之间拉伸的橡皮筋组成。
当入口旋转时,橡皮筋有效地抓住球。
入口可以旋转以拉入球,或反转以释放球。
Intake 电机的动力通过两个 10 毫米 (mm) 皮带轮和橡胶带进行传输。
这提供了平稳的权力转移。 如果球卡在入口处,橡胶带只会滑动,从而防止任何损坏。
曲柄设计弹射点火系统
Fling 弹射臂的发射机构是一个非常平滑的往复装置。
它由一组 60 个齿轮和一个铰接张紧臂组成。
张紧臂在连接到齿轮外边缘的销上枢转。 当齿轮转动时,这会产生曲柄设置。
齿轮与枢轴连接的另一侧是轴衬套。 衬套将卡住张紧臂并增加曲柄的长度。
当曲柄使铰接张紧臂变短时,它会向下拉弹射器臂并增加弹射器臂橡皮筋上的张力。
一旦曲柄连杆移过过中心点,轴衬套就会失去与曲柄连杆的接触并释放张紧臂,从而发射弹射器。
随着齿轮继续转动,整个循环不断重复。 保险杠开关设置为在弹射臂到达其过中心点之前触发停止齿轮转动的行为。
这允许将球从入口装载到弹射器臂上。
用于移动弹射器臂的复合齿轮比
任何曾经试图握住扫帚柄末端来拿起扫帚的人都会经历过旋转扭矩。
弹射臂的齿轮系统需要有足够的旋转扭矩来克服臂橡皮筋的张力。 另外,弹射臂是用来悬挂在吊杆上的,所以它也需要有足够的扭矩来举起机器人的重量。
该扭矩是通过使用两级复合齿轮比产生的。
复合齿轮比的第一部分有12齿主动齿轮,由电机提供动力。
12 齿主动齿轮驱动 36 齿从动齿轮。
此 12 齿齿轮变为 36 齿齿轮,提供 3:1 的齿轮比。
36齿齿轮以电机速度的1/3旋转。 然而,它将 3 倍的旋转扭矩传递到其轴上。
复合齿轮比的第二部分有一对12齿主动齿轮。 这 12 齿齿轮与复合齿轮比第一部分的 36 齿齿轮共用同一根轴。
弹射器发射机构上的一对12齿齿轮和一对60齿齿轮之间有一对36齿惰轮。 惰轮不会改变传动比。
这 12 个齿的齿轮变成 60 个齿的齿轮,提供 5:1 的齿轮比。
将 3:1 和 5:1 两个传动比组合起来形成 15:1 的复合传动比
弹射器电机的旋转扭矩接近 15 倍,这为 Fling 提供了充足的旋转扭矩,既可以发射弹射器臂,又可以使用悬挂杆将其重量抬离场地。
- 有关齿轮比、链轮和滑轮的更多信息, 请查看 VEX 库中的这篇文章。
使用 VEXcode IQ 进行 Fling 编程的提示和技巧
配置 Fling 的传动系统
请按照 VEX 库中本文中的步骤 操作,了解有关如何配置 2 电机传动系统的一般信息。
要配置 Fling 的特定 2 电机传动系统,请为左电机选择端口 1,为右电机选择端口 3。
配置弹射臂和进气电机
按照 VEX 库中本文 中的步骤获取有关如何配置电机的一般信息。
- 要配置 Fling 的特定进气电机,请选择端口 2。
- 要配置 Fling 的特定弹射臂电机,请选择端口 4。
配置缓冲开关
请按照 VEX 库中本文 中的步骤操作,了解有关如何配置缓冲开关的一般信息。
要配置 Fling 的特定 Bumper Switch,请选择端口 5。
配置控制器
IQ 控制器可配置为驱动 Fling 以及控制 Intake。
按照 VEX 库中本文 中的步骤获取有关如何配置控制器的一般信息。
注:Fling 的配置 NOT 允许 VEX IQ Brain 的默认驱动程序与控制器配合使用。
控制器上的任何按钮组都可以用来控制 Fling 的摄入量。
注:在配置控制器之前必须先配置 Fling 的 Intake。
将弹射臂电机与控制器结合使用
将 CatapultArmMotor 停止设置为保持。 这将使 Fling 的弹射臂在悬挂后保持在适当的位置。
选择一个控制器按钮来设置 Fling 的弹射臂开火。
选择一个控制器按钮来发射弹射器臂。
此按钮还会向下移动手臂,以允许 Fling 悬挂在悬挂杆上。
有关如何使用 VEXcode IQ 编写 Fling 代码的更多信息, 请查看 VEX 库中的这些文章。